<!--  Begin hiding script

var errString //= "The following errors occurred:\n\n"
var errIndex //= "0"

function checkText(a, title) {
	var err = "0"
    var checkRef = "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z-'. "
    for (i = 0; i < document.reqForm.elements[a].value.length; i++){
    	var theChar = document.reqForm.elements[a].value.charAt(i)
        var validChar = checkRef.indexOf(theChar)
        if (validChar == "-1") {
			err = "1" 
        }
    }
	if (err == "1") {
	 	errString = errString + "\t" + title + "\n"
		errIndex = "1"
	}
}

function checkReqText(a, title) {
	var err = "0"
	var checkRef = "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z-'. "
	if ((document.reqForm.elements[a].value == "") || (document.reqForm.elements[a].value == null)) {
		err = "1"
	}
    for (i = 0; i < document.reqForm.elements[a].value.length; i++) {
		var theChar = document.reqForm.elements[a].value.charAt(i)
		var validChar = checkRef.indexOf(theChar)
		if (validChar == "-1"){
			err = "1"
		}    
	}
	if (err == "1") {
	 	errString = errString + "\t" + title + "\n"
		errIndex = "1"
	}
}

function checkTextAndNum(a, title) {
	var err = "0"
    var checkRef = "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z1234567890-',.() "
    for (i = 0; i < document.reqForm.elements[a].value.length; i++){
    	var theChar = document.reqForm.elements[a].value.charAt(i)
        var validChar = checkRef.indexOf(theChar)
        if (validChar == "-1") {
			err = "1" 
        }
    }
	if (err == "1") {
	 	errString = errString + "\t" + title + "\n"
		errIndex = "1"
	}
}

function checkReqTextAndNum(a, title) {
	var err = "0"
	var checkRef = "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z1234567890-',.() "
	if ((document.reqForm.elements[a].value == "") || (document.reqForm.elements[a].value == null)) {
		err = "1"
	}
    for (i = 0; i < document.reqForm.elements[a].value.length; i++) {
		var theChar = document.reqForm.elements[a].value.charAt(i)
		var validChar = checkRef.indexOf(theChar)
		if (validChar == "-1"){
			errString = errString + "\t" + title + "\n"
		}    
	}
	if (err == "1") {
	 	errString = errString + "\t" + title + "\n"
		errIndex = "1"
	}
}

function checkNumbers(a, title) {
	var err = "0"
     var checkRef = "1234567890, =-()"
     for (i = 0; i < document.reqForm.elements[a].value.length; i++) {
     	var theChar = document.reqForm.elements[a].value.charAt(i)
		var validChar = checkRef.indexOf(theChar)
        if (validChar == "-1"){
			err = "1"
		}
     }
	 if (err == "1") {
	 	errString = errString + "\t" + title + "\n"
		errIndex = "1"
	}
}

function checkReqNumbers(a, title) {
	var checkRef = "1234567890, =-()"
	var err = "0"
    if ((document.reqForm.elements[a].value == "") || (document.reqForm.elements[a].value == null)) {
		err = "1"
	}
	for (i = 0; i < document.reqForm.elements[a].value.length; i++) {
		var theChar = document.reqForm.elements[a].value.charAt(i)
		var validChar = checkRef.indexOf(theChar)
		if (validChar == "-1"){
			err = "1"
		}
	}
	if (err == "1") {
	 	errString = errString + "\t" + title + "\n"
		errIndex = "1"
	}    
}

function checkReqEmail(a, title) {
	var checkRef = "@"
	var err = "0"
    if ((document.reqForm.elements[a].value == "") || (document.reqForm.elements[a].value == null)) {
		err = "1"
	}
	var theString = document.reqForm.elements[a].value
	var validChar = theString.indexOf(checkRef)
	if (validChar == "-1"){
		err = "1"
	}
	if (err == "1") {
	 	errString = errString + "\t" + title + "\n"
		errIndex = "1"
	}    
}

function checkEmail(a, title) {
	var checkRef = "@"
	var err = "0"
    var theString = document.reqForm.elements[a].value
	var validChar = theString.indexOf(checkRef)
	if (validChar == "-1"){
		err = "1"
	}
	if (err == "1") {
	 	errString = errString + "\t" + title + "\n"
		errIndex = "1"
	}    
}

function checkReq(a, title) {
	var err = "0"
    if ((document.reqForm.elements[a].value == "") || (document.reqForm.elements[a].value == null)) {
		err = "1"
	}
	
	if (err == "1") {
	 	errString = errString + "\t" + title + "\n"
		errIndex = "1"
	}    
}

function checkList(a) {

	var choice = document.reqForm.elements[a].options[0].selected
	if (choice) {
		errString = errString + "\tState\n"
		errIndex = "1"
	}
}

function checkReqField(a, title) {
	var err = "0"
	if ((document.reqForm.elements[a].value == "") || (document.reqForm.elements[a].value == null)) {
		err = "1"
	}

	if (err == "1") {
	 	errString = errString + "\t" + title + "\n"
		errIndex = "1"
	}
}

	function redirectForm(url) {
		if (document.reqForm.topic.value == "") {
			document.reqForm.action = url
			document.reqForm.submit()
		}	
	}

// End Hiding -->